Study for 'Justice,' Lunette in Hudson County Courthouse, Jersey City, NJ, Kenyon Cox, American, 1856–1919, Charcoal and graphite on off-white wove paper, laid down, Allegorical representation of Justice holding bowls of a scale in each hand. Her hair is in ringlets held back by a band. She is seated on a chair with ball and claw feet, and her foot is visible, sticking out from beneath her drapery., 1910, mural designs, Drawing, Drawing
